Medical Triage and Advice
How we support members with medical concerns
If the Care Specialist determines that the nature of a member's concerns are clinical in nature, then a registered nurse will complete a clinical assessment with the member. Our nurses utilise the Manchester Triage System (MTS) for all clinical support. The MTS is a widely recognised clinical risk management tool used by clinicians worldwide to enable our clinicians to safely manage member support. Our goal is to work with the member to prioritise and categorise their needs, so they can be connected with the most appropriate support within our stepped care model.
Our registered nurses may provide direct clinical advice when it is appropriate for members to self-manage their presenting symptoms. This may also include advice for over-the-counter medication and specific in-app tools to assist with common symptoms. Advice may include specific clinical self help tools for the member or for family under their care.
Overseas Vaccinations
Members who have received vaccinations overseas may be required to supply their immunisation record in Australia. We can provide members with an authenticated vaccine certificate within 1 business day through the Australian Government Provider Digital Access for health professional online services. We will require basic personal information and the member’s non-Australian vaccine record and can guide the member through creating a ‘myGov’ user if required.
